Actually in order. 1) Tsubasa Reservoir Chronicle- A group of dimension travelers goes from world to world trying to get back a princess' memories. Two are from the same world, the other two are from entirely different dimensions. So you basically have a princess with no memories, (Sakura) her childhood best friend doing his best to get her memories back, even though she'll never remember him, (Syaoran) a ninja with anger problems, (Kurogane) and a wizard who is hiding a lot of secrets, and definitely isn't trying very hard to stay alive. (Fai) Oh, and Mokona. It gets really dark, and is my favorite CLAMP work. KuroFai is my eternal OTP. I want to go on and on about how wonderful it is all the time. 2) X- One of their bloodiest manga to date, it's about a boy, Kamui Shiro who has to choose between saving the earth, (by killing humanity) or saving humanity. (Thereby dooming the earth to a slow painful death) Really good. 3)CardCaptor Sakura- Starring Syaoran and Sakura again, but they aren't the same people. This one is much more lighthearted, and is a very cute magical girl story with some twists. You'll find pretty much every type of relationship you can think of in here. (Yaoi, yuri, age differences, straight, ect.) 4)Tokyo Babylon- Starring Subaru, who is also in X, but unlike with CCS and TRS, it really is the same guy. He can see spirits and is trying to help them pass on. But then he starts to fall in love with Seishiro, who really, seriously, is not at all like he appears. Really sad. Don't read it if you're not ready for heartbreak. 5)Clamp School Detectives- Such a small one, but I love it a lot. I like to rewatch the anime, and reread the manga. It's just about three young boys who do their best, (which is pretty darn great) to solve crimes and mysteries.
